Transaction 58408998e96ff8597068b9eb78a281da4d84ed1034153ea54112b7b7c76eb242

1 Input
2 Outputs
  • 58408998e96ff8597068b9eb78a281da4d84ed1034153ea54112b7b7c76eb242:0
  • value  28000000
    address  mgSigbyLu5fr6R48AG8rzpeLGWx2TPpqoo
  • 58408998e96ff8597068b9eb78a281da4d84ed1034153ea54112b7b7c76eb242:1
  • value  655042259
    address  mnuphje1BK9Ad5d5Lr6iUXfZbHa1RWfgWD